RESUMO

The main objective of this work is to study the phase separation phenomena in a vertical tee. A two-dimensional computer code was used to solve the two-fluid model equations, using the finite volume method. A fundamental part is the development of simple model to viscous diffusion term, assuming laminar flow. Special attention is directed to the modelling of the constitutive equation for the interfacial friction term. The phase separation was simulated considering two values of branch-to-inlet diameter ratio, 0.5 and 1, according to reported experimental results . Detailed distributions of void fraction, pressure and velocity of both phases are presented. A good agreement was obtained between the computer code results and the experimental data, when the extraction rate was greater than 0.3. The mean deviation for these data was about 10 %. For lower extraction rate, a three - dimensional model would be more suitable. ln this case, the mean deviation for alI data was about 25 %, with a tendency of the split ratio to be under predicted.
